Well tomorrow ( Feb 5th ) is the big day . We leave for Medina Del Compo Spain to volunteer at the SCOOBY shelter for a week. We will be returning Feb 12th and returning with us will be Rocio, Patitas and Erol, 3 lucky Galgos who will be looking for their Forever Homes here in the USA. We will try to keep an updated account of the trip and our experiences there to share and hopefully we will have some interesting photos and video footage to post .

It’s been a while, but I thought you would all like a quick update on Matrix. He is happy and healthy and spoiled beyond repair! In a nutshell, if I were doing half as well as my dog is, I’d be in great shape!
Matrix sleeps every night snuggled between his mommy and daddy. In fact, one of us usually ends up sleeping with one leg hanging off the bed. Those long legs take up so much darn space! Every night and every morning he receives a full doggy massage. What a way to begin and end every day. He wears only the latest fashions in coats, snoods and martingale collars.
Matrix has two girlfriends. One is Snoopy…she is a brindle boxer-pitbull mix. But his favorite is Brindie…also a retired racer (aka Be Singing). He looooooves having the ladies over. He also spends time with his 3 cousins Monty (golden retriever), King (mix) and Buster (mix) who are all male. He just loves the company of other dogs. Matrix gets along remarkably well with his two feline brothers Max and Sam. It doesn’t happen often, but occasionally we catch them licking each other and sleeping together.
Matrix also enjoys green beans, cheese, squeaky toys (naturally), plain organic yogurt, apples and anything that qualifies as a “treat.” In fact, when we get home from the grocery store, Matrix enjoys scanning the grocery bags and finding his own toy/treat. Sort of like an Easter egg. And of course there is always a toy/treat hiding in a bag for him. It’s so hard to resist the temptations in the pet aisle…especially when your dog is as good as Matrix.
